So... I wondered when I first saw the Flamed Out collection, if that was actually going to be the Hunger Games Collection, and from what I've seen, there's a LOT of crossover between the two. Makes sense, I guess. If it bombs, they can just pretend it was going to be limited edition all along, and if it succeeds... well, the Flamed Out collection is a way for our favorites to live on!

After seeing a couple of the featured District Looks on CoverGirl's site, I had also been wondering if they were going to branch into nail art stickers, and it turns out, I was right. Flamed Out, Tawny Flame, Crimson Blaze, Inferno, Seared Bronze, and Red Hot Rebellion are the names of the stickers, and with the exception of the last two, feature a flame design of some kind. Every now and then, I enjoy looking back over past manicures. Creatively, it's just neat to see how far I've come since the days I started. Oddly enough, when I chose this prompt, I knew exactly which manicure I wanted to recreate. Based loosely on Fishbowl Friday 027 , today's seriotype nails are a RECREATION ...  Polishes Used: 1 Coat Fingerpaints Smooth Over Ridge Filler 3 Coats China Glaze Violet Vibes Essie Leggy Legend Pahlish Autumn People Pure Ice Get in Line SinfulShine Konstellation 2 Coats SinfulColors Clear Coat 1 Coat Seche Vite Looking back, I can honestly say that my seriotype game has come far since I first learned the method. One of the things that took me a while to master was the balance of nail polish finishes. While seriotypes made exclusively with creme polishes look cool, those made with a combination of different finishes really pop. There's more depth involved when you layer a metallic over a jelly neon and
